Choosing the Right Shoes for Standing on Cement
Standing on cement all day can be incredibly taxing on your feet, legs, and back. The hard, unyielding surface offers little to no give, leading to fatigue, pain, and even long-term health issues. Selecting the right footwear is crucial for mitigating these effects. Here’s a breakdown of key features to consider when choosing shoes for prolonged standing on cement:
Cushioning & Support: The Foundation of Comfort
This is arguably the most important factor. Cement provides zero natural cushioning, so your shoes must compensate. Look for shoes with substantial cushioning in the midsole.
- Fresh Foam/EVA Foam: Materials like New Balance’s Fresh Foam X or EVA foam are excellent choices, providing a plush, shock-absorbing layer between your foot and the hard surface. More cushioning generally translates to greater comfort during extended periods of standing.
- Arch Support: Proper arch support is vital for maintaining alignment and preventing foot fatigue. Shoes with built-in arch support, or the ability to accommodate custom orthotics, can significantly reduce strain. Consider your arch type (high, neutral, or flat) when selecting a shoe.
- Impact Absorption: Technologies like Timberland PRO’s Anti-Fatigue Technology actively return energy to your feet, reducing strain and improving comfort throughout the day.
Outsole Features: Grip and Durability
The outsole is your connection to the cement floor. It needs to provide both reliable grip and withstand the abrasive nature of the surface.
- Slip Resistance: Cement can become slippery, especially if wet or oily. Look for outsoles specifically designed with slip-resistant patterns.
- Abrasion Resistance: Cement is abrasive and will wear down shoe outsoles quickly. Durable rubber outsoles are essential for longevity.
- Oil Resistance: If working in an environment with oils or other fluids, ensure the outsole is oil-resistant to prevent slips and damage to the shoe.
Safety Features (If Applicable)
Depending on your work environment, safety features might be non-negotiable.
- Safety Toe (Steel or Alloy): If you work with heavy objects or in a hazardous environment, a safety toe is critical to protect against impacts and compression. Alloy toes offer a lighter weight alternative to steel.
- Electrical Hazard Protection: If there’s a risk of contact with electrical sources, look for shoes that meet ASTM F2412-18a standards for electrical hazard protection.
- Kevlar Insoles: These provide puncture resistance, protecting your feet from sharp objects underfoot.
Fit and Construction
Even the best features won’t matter if the shoe doesn’t fit properly.
- Width: Shoes available in multiple widths are ideal, ensuring a comfortable and secure fit.
- Breathability: Look for breathable materials like mesh or leather to prevent overheating and moisture buildup.
- Slip-On vs. Lace-Up: Slip-on shoes offer convenience, but lace-up shoes generally provide a more secure and adjustable fit.
